Adjective [English]

Etymology: anti- + microtubulin Etymology templates: {{prefix|en|anti|microtubulin}} anti- + microtubulin Head templates: {{en-adj|-}} antimicrotubulin (not comparable)
  1. That counters the effect of microtubulin Tags: not-comparable
